Queen Elizabeth Leisure Centre

From: Cabinet - Tuesday, 10th September, 2024 6.30 pm - September 10, 2024

...Cabinet noted the report on the Queen Elizabeth Leisure Centre, acknowledged past and present financial contributions, affirmed the Trust's autonomy over the facility's future, committed to accelerating the Leisure Strategy, and pledged support to the Trust and community groups to facilitate school and community access to the swimming pool if it reopens.
